Passer au contenu principal
Connexion ACUL
Classe d’implémentation pour l’écran de connexion
Example
import Login from "@auth0/auth0-acul-js/login";
const loginManager = new Login();
loginManager.login({
  username: "testUser",
  password: "testPassword"
});

Constructeurs

Connexion
Constructor
Crée une instance du gestionnaire de l’écran de connexion

Propriétés

branding
client
organization
prompt
screen
tenant
transaction
untrustedData
user
screenIdentifier
string

Méthodes

federatedLogin
Promise<void>
Effectue une connexion avec un fournisseur d’identité sociale
Example
import Login from "@auth0/auth0-acul-js/login";
const loginManager = new Login();
loginManager.federatedLogin({
  connection: "google-oauth2"
});
getErrors
Récupère le tableau d’erreurs de transaction à partir du contexte, ou un tableau vide s’il n’y en a aucune.Un tableau d’objets d’erreur provenant du contexte de la transaction.
getLoginIdentifiers
Fonction utilitaireRenvoie les types d’identifiants actifs pour l’écran de connexionUn tableau de types d’identifiants actifs ou null si aucun n’est actif
Example
import Login from "@auth0/auth0-acul-js/login";
const loginManager = new Login();
loginManager.getLoginIdentifiers();
login
Promise<void>
Effectue une connexion avec un nom d’utilisateur et un mot de passe
Example
import Login from "@auth0/auth0-acul-js/login";
const loginManager = new Login();
loginManager.login({
  username: "testUser",
  password: "testPassword"
});
pickCountryCode
Promise<void>
Sélectionne le code de pays pour la saisie du numéro de téléphone
Example
import Login from "@auth0/auth0-acul-js/login";
const loginManager = new Login();
loginManager.pickCountryCode();